#620687 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#620687 is composed of 38.4% red, 2.4%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.4% cyan, 95.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 282.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 27.6%. #620687 color hex could be obtained by blending #c40cff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#620687 color description : Dark violet.

#620687 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#620687 has RGB values of R:98, G:6,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 6424199.

Shades and Tints of #620687

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030004 is the darkest color, while #faf0fe is the lightest one.
